1.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

If a shirt originally costs $40 and is on sale for 20% off, what is the sale price of the shirt?

$32

$35

$30

$25

2.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

If a student scored 85% on a test with 50 questions, how many questions did they answer correctly?

45

40

48

42

3.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

A store increased the price of a product by 15%. If the original price was $80, what is the new price?

$90

$85

$95

$92

4.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

If a recipe calls for 2 cups of flour and you only have 75% of the required amount, how many cups of flour do you have?

1.5 cups

1.25 cups

1.75 cups

2.5 cups

5.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

If a company's revenue increased by 25% from last year, and last year's revenue was $500,000, what is the current revenue?

$575,000

$525,000

$700,000

$625,000

6.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

If a phone originally costs $600 and is discounted by 30%, what is the discounted price of the phone?

$450

$500

$420

$380

7.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

A student answered 18 out of 20 questions correctly on a quiz. What percentage of questions did they answer correctly?

90%

85%

80%

95%
